A language case study is a detailed examination of a specific language or group of languages. It typically involves the analysis of various aspects of the language, including its phonology, syntax, semantics, and social context. Case studies can be conducted on individual languages, as well as on language families or language groups.

One example of a language case study is the examination of the Bantu language family, which consists of over 500 languages spoken throughout Africa. Bantu languages are known for their complex verb systems, which often involve multiple prefixes and suffixes to indicate tense, aspect, and other grammatical features. A case study of the Bantu language family would involve analyzing the structure and function of these verb systems, as well as examining the social and cultural context in which they are used.

Another example of a language case study is the examination of pidgin and creole languages. Pidgin languages are simplified versions of other languages that develop when speakers of different languages need to communicate with each other, often in a trade or colonial context. Creole languages, on the other hand, are fully-fledged languages that emerge from pidgin languages when they are used as the native language of a community. A case study of pidgin and creole languages would involve analyzing the structure and development of these languages, as well as examining the social and historical context in which they arose.

Language case studies can be conducted using a variety of methods, including fieldwork, corpus analysis, and experimental studies. They can be useful for a wide range of purposes, including language documentation, language learning, and linguistic research. Overall, language case studies provide valuable insights into the structure and function of language, as well as the cultural and social context in which it is used.
